Astoria Teen, 16, Missing From Home Since Last Week, Police Say
The Queens teen left her Astoria Houses apartment last Thursday evening and hasn't been seen since, police said.

ASTORIA, QUEENS — An Astoria teenager disappeared from her home last week, police said.
Gloria Louis, 16, was last seen leaving her Astoria Houses apartment at about 7:00 p.m. on Jan. 20 wearing a black jacket and black sneakers, according to the NYPD.
Louis hasn't been seen since, said police, who were still looking for her as of Jan. 24.

The teen stands 5 feet 4 inches tall, has brown eyes, and black hair with red streaks, records show.
The NYPD shared a photo of Louis and asked anyone with information about her whereabouts to call the NYPD's Crime Stoppers hotline at 1-800-577-TIPS (8477) or for Spanish, 1-888-57-PISTA (74782).
